A 10-foot shipping container offers a versatile amount of storage. To ensure it accommodates your specific requirements, let's examine its dimensions. These containers are typically 8 feet wide and 10 feet long, with a height of 9 feet. Remember that these are typical dimensions, and slight alterations may occur.

But what constitutes the weight of a standard 10-foot container?
The answer, like most things in shipping, depends on several factors. A bare 10ft container, devoid of any added features, typically weighs around 3,500 pounds. However, the inclusion of steel reinforcements, insulation, or specialized flooring can significantly adjust this figure.
